Decoded Frontend Angular Interview Hacking Jun 2026

Why this passes: It demonstrates proper use of switchMap (canceling obsolete in-flight requests), distinctUntilChanged (preventing redundant processing), and resilient error handling that keeps the master stream active. Challenge 2: Bridging RxJS and Signals smoothly

Decoded: Frontend Angular Interview Hacking To "hack" an Angular interview isn’t about shortcuts; it’s about demonstrating a deep architectural understanding that separates a component-shoveler from a true Senior Engineer. While junior candidates focus on syntax, successful candidates focus on predictability, performance, and state management 1. The Reactive Core: Mastering RxJS

If you only have 2 hours to prepare, memorize these specific "Hacker" responses:

Ignores new incoming observables while the current inner observable is still executing. This is perfect for preventing double-submits on login buttons. 3. The Modern Angular Paradigm: Signals

are synchronous and represent a value that changes over time. They are excellent for managing local UI state because they track dependencies automatically, eliminating the need for zone.js in future applications. decoded frontend angular interview hacking

Running high-frequency operations outside Angular via NgZone.runOutsideAngular .

Decoded: Frontend Angular Interview Hacking – The Ultimate Guide to Landing Your Senior Role

“A memory leak caused the app to crash after 30 minutes. I used takeUntil in every component, added a lint rule for unsubscribing, and reduced heap usage by 60%.”

Mention DomSanitizer and how Angular prevents Cross-Site Scripting (XSS) by default. Why this passes: It demonstrates proper use of

This question is often asked to gauge your understanding of different frontend frameworks. Be prepared to explain the key differences between Angular and React, including their architecture, syntax, and use cases.

Queues inner observables sequentially. Use this for critical database updates where order matters.

Signals do not replace RxJS. You should explain to your interviewer that Signals are ideal for state management and synchronous UI presentation , while RxJS remains the gold standard for asynchronous event streams, data orchestration, and race conditions . Advanced Change Detection Strategies

Now that we've covered the common and advanced interview questions, here are some tips and tricks to help you ace your Angular interview: The Reactive Core: Mastering RxJS If you only

“Create a star‑rating component that works with Angular forms.” Hack steps:

Understand that Zone.js intercepts asynchronous events to trigger change detection, and how you can run code outside Angular ( ngZone.runOutsideAngular ) to boost performance. RxJS and State Management

Senior roles require a strong grasp of component interaction patterns and low-level template rendering APIs. Smart vs. Presentational Components

Find a Headrush Dealer

or